YES... its right.
As far as how deep and how wide? I have no idea what you mean. Its a thread form. Its specified in Machinery's Handbook and other reference guides. If you're looking for the length of the threads, I'd say about 1.25", but it wouldn't matter. If you're threading the lever, go longer than the threads in the **** and it'll bottom out, if you're tapping the ****, then just run a tap up it, its a blind hole and you can only go so far.
